Output 8abe0163535a66a8a15f3957ec2e561e24cb21e5e608ee52a80a931e6d919829:1

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38eed7a7c2eb08a8205b1189135c394d5875a8e OP_EQUAL
address
3LydiomhgojTxtDXGT8okKNeY1xxoAkfK9
transaction
8abe0163535a66a8a15f3957ec2e561e24cb21e5e608ee52a80a931e6d919829
confirmations
172231
spent
true